
如何导入python中的模块
用户关注问题
Python模块导入的基本方法有哪些?
我刚开始学习Python,想知道有哪些简单的方法可以把一个模块导入到我的代码中?
Python模块导入的基础方法
在Python中,常用的导入模块方法是使用import关键字,比如写import module_name。这样可以引入整个模块。也可以使用from module_name import specific_function形式,直接导入模块中的特定功能。
如何避免导入模块时出现命名冲突?
我想把多个模块导入到项目中,但担心它们内部有相同的函数或变量名,应该怎样处理这类冲突?
通过别名避免命名冲突
使用import module_name as alias可以给模块起一个别名,避免名字冲突。例如,import numpy as np或import pandas as pd。这样调用时使用别名,清晰且避免重名。
如何导入自定义的Python模块?
除了标准库模块,我写了自己的模块文件,如何在其他Python程序里导入并使用它?
导入自定义模块的步骤
只要自定义模块文件(比如mymodule.py)在当前目录或Python路径中,可以直接import mymodule。如果不在,可以通过修改sys.path或设置PYTHONPATH环境变量来让解释器找到模块。